Oklahoma State will face off against Savannah State from the FCS level in their first game of the season.Follow @SBNationCFB


No longer led offensively by Brandon Weeden and Justin Blackmon, the Cowboys are going to have a much tougher time taking the Big 12 title in 2012 than in last season, a year that would have seen the 'Boys head to the national championship if not for a loss to Iowa State.
There should be no excuses for OSU to not start 1-0, though, with one of the worst teams to ever grace their schedule heading into Boone Pickens Stadium. Savannah State is a lowly FCS team that hasn’t won more than three games in a season in the past decade and will be facing their first ever major college competition in OSU.
Offensive offseason losses or not, there should be no issues for the Cowboys and freshman starting QB Wes Lunt in dismantling the Tigers for their first win of the year.
Game time, TV channel: 7 p.m. ET, FOX College Sports
